Kingston

Experience the local lifestyle in Canberra’s bold southern precinct, Kingston.

A perfectly preserved 1920s streetscape gives Canberra’s most populated residential neighbourhood an eye-catching edge. Look for the red-brick relics, which now host a tastebud-tingling collection of cafés, bars and restaurants. Hit the waterfront on the Kingston Foreshore, which reliably delivers great eats and a humming atmosphere year-round. Galleries, markets and handcrafted creations give Kingston an unmistakable community vibe. Explore Kingston’s boutiques and meet the makers first hand.
